Transaction 192c05b16f714cb538b97b911135abbfd18ff76653eefe4f412871fcdee03a3f
1 Input
2 Outputs
- 192c05b16f714cb538b97b911135abbfd18ff76653eefe4f412871fcdee03a3f:0
- 192c05b16f714cb538b97b911135abbfd18ff76653eefe4f412871fcdee03a3f:1
value 225693
address 3G3TBRGQiGVrvHQMopDMkUx1FusP11tRY6
value 17805878
address 1EVWgDMXBrhwnTnUfugQCRxNE3fFFCsj9P